Home blood pressure monitors aren't that reliable but that is at the upper end of normal so I would try and bring the midwife appointment forward or get it checked by the doctor just in case.

However, keep an eye on that blood pressure - if you're worried make an emergency appointment with the nurse or Dr at your surgery to get it re-checked today. If you're having headaches, legs swell etc ring the delivery suite and tell them you're on your way in as are concerned.
